Strategies and tactics for expanding into rural and semi-urban markets for Kerala Naturals

  • ⛳️ Strategy 1: Conduct thorough market research

    • Identify target rural and semi-urban areas by analysing demographic data
    • Conduct surveys to understand consumer preferences and awareness levels
    • Visit focus groups to gather qualitative insights on consumer habits
    • Analyse local competition and market share distribution
    • Assess distribution channels and logistics critical for these regions
    • Utilise secondary data from market research reports for rural South India
    • Examine economic conditions and purchasing power in targeted areas
    • Evaluate consumer trends for natural and eco-friendly products
    • Identify influencers and local leaders who can provide market insights
    • Compile findings to gauge demand potential and advise on product adjustments
  • ⛳️ Strategy 2: Tailor marketing strategies for local engagement

    • Create campaigns highlighting the benefits of ayurvedic products
    • Use local dialect and regional appeal in marketing materials
    • Engage local influencers and community leaders to enhance brand credibility
    • Organise product demonstrations and sampling events in local fairs
    • Collaborate with local media for coverage and advertisements
    • Develop educational content about product benefits and usage
    • Offer promotional discounts and loyalty programmes to first-time buyers
    • Leverage social media platforms popular in the targeted regions
    • Participate in local health camps and events to build brand presence
    • Monitor campaign performance and feedback to refine strategies
  • ⛳️ Strategy 3: Establish robust distribution networks

    • Identify and partner with local distributors familiar with rural markets
    • Set up a supply chain system ensuring easy access to products
    • Negotiate with retailers for prominent shelf space in local stores
    • Utilise existing local distribution channels for quicker penetration
    • Implement an efficient ordering system with flexible payment terms
    • Train sales staff on products and customer service tailored to rural areas
    • Establish inventory hubs in strategic locations for quick replenishment
    • Evaluate partnerships with e-commerce platforms catering to rural areas
    • Explore direct selling or franchise models to widen reach
    • Continuously assess distribution strategy based on feedback and sales data

Strategies and tactics for developing a Year Plan for Skincare Distribution

  • ⛳️ Strategy 1: Expand geographical reach

    • Conduct market research to identify potential new cities and regions within Libya, Tunisia, and Algeria
    • Establish partnerships with local distributors or agents in untapped areas
    • Set up regional distribution centres to ensure timely delivery and stock availability
    • Attend local trade shows and industry events to network and promote products
    • Develop relationships with local clinics and estheticians through meet-and-greet events
    • Assess and optimise logistics and supply chain management for efficient distribution
    • Identify and target key opinion leaders in new regions for endorsements
    • Create promotional materials localising the marketing for each specific region
    • Offer product demonstrations and training sessions for potential new clients
    • Measure and report on the success of expansions quarterly to adjust strategies as needed
  • ⛳️ Strategy 2: Enhance brand visibility

    • Launch a comprehensive digital marketing campaign targeting skincare professionals
    • Utilise social media platforms popular in the region for brand promotions
    • Collaborate with beauty influencers and skincare bloggers for product reviews
    • Create engaging content showcasing the benefits and results of the products
    • Invest in search engine optimisation to improve online visibility in relevant markets
    • Develop a loyalty programme for existing customers to encourage repeat business
    • Sponsor industry conferences and events to increase brand credibility and recognition
    • Ensure strategic placement of advertisements in industry magazines and publications
    • Regularly update the product portfolio and promotions on the company website
    • Gather and act on feedback from customers and clients to constantly improve brand perception
  • ⛳️ Strategy 3: Enhance product training and education

    • Develop a series of online training modules for estheticians focusing on product use
    • Host monthly webinars with industry experts discussing the latest in skincare technology
    • Provide educational resources to clinics highlighting the benefits of the product line
    • Offer incentives for clinics and estheticians to complete training programmes
    • Launch a certification programme for professionals using your product lines
    • Create case study materials showing successful client transformations
    • Organise on-site training workshops in key cities with high client concentrations
    • Establish a helpline or chat system for quick access to product information and queries
    • Distribute educational newsletters with the latest product developments
    • Conduct annual user feedback sessions to understand training gaps and needs
